NINE SENTENCED IN LATEST DISTRICT COURT

  

 

A Brenham man has been sentenced to two years in prison after his arrest just over a year ago by Brenham Police.

29-year old Eric Michael Ellis, was charged with Evading Arrest with Previous Conviction – a State Jail Felony.

Ellis was arrested after police attempted to conduct a traffic stop in the area of Blinn Blvd. and West Main Streets.  Once the vehicle came to a stop, Ellis reportedly fled on foot but was later apprehended.
